Actually it makes no difference if the apt-build files are in
/etc/apt/sources.list.d if the deb line is already at the top of
sources.list. As long as the /etc/apt/preferences file is set up
correctly, apt-build will install from the local repository first (I had
to use --force-yes for authentication reasons to get to work).
